Common Locksmith Issues in Bozeman, MT

Bozeman's harsh winters cause lock mechanisms to freeze and contract, while spring thaw cycles create moisture issues in older homes near campus and downtown. Many properties built during the 1970s mining boom have original hardware that fails unexpectedly. High-altitude UV exposure also degrades exterior lock finishes faster than typical climates.

Locksmith Costs in Bozeman

Locksmith services in Bozeman typically range from $85-150 for standard lockouts, $120-250 for lock installations, and $200-400 for comprehensive security upgrades. Prices reflect Montana's rural logistics and specialized cold-weather equipment needs. Emergency winter calls may include weather surcharges during severe conditions.

Seasonal Locksmith Tips

Before winter hits Bozeman, lubricate exterior locks with graphite-based products and check weatherstripping. Keep de-icer handy for frozen mechanisms, and consider upgrading to cold-rated deadbolts if your locks frequently jam below zero.

How do winter temperatures affect locks in Bozeman?

Bozeman's subzero winters cause metal lock components to contract and lubricants to thicken. Regular graphite treatment and cold-rated locks prevent freezing and ensure reliable operation during harsh weather.
